"Between Mission and Cartel"
Pros: Light,
Cons:
There is nothing special about these bindings. You are paying more than Burton Missions because it has better toe straps but the overall feel is definitely below Cartels. I will mention that these bindings are extremely light and that's probably the only good thing about the bindings. Do yourself a favor, pay a little bit more and get the Cartels!

"quick demo"
Pros: smooth ratchets, comfy straps, good mid flex
Cons: toe strap slips at times, design? ,
got a quick ride in these bindings. like most burton bindings, they're super comfy and have very smooth ratchets. only flaw i found was that the toe straps slip sometimes if you use them as a cap strap. not a big fan of the design, but they're a good mid flex binding. not as stiff as cartels, so if you're looking for a good cheap binding in the park, not a bad option to consider here.
